别再用Windows思维了!在liux平台下这样操作效率翻倍
为什么你的liux平台用起来总是不顺手?
最近收到很多读者留言,说在liux平台下工作总是找不到Windows的感觉。
其实啊,这就像让习惯开自动挡的人突然开手动挡——不是车不好,是你还没掌握技巧!
今天我就用15年运维经验,带你玩转liux平台的高效工作流。
liux平台文件管理的正确打开方式
记住这个黄金法则:能用终端就别用图形界面!在liux平台下,这些命令组合比鼠标点点点快10倍:
find . -name "*.log" | xargs grep "error"
- 一键搜索所有日志中的错误rsync -avz /source /backup
- 比cp更智能的文件同步rename 's/.txt/.md/' *.txt
- 批量修改文件后缀
新手最容易踩的坑
很多从Windows转来的朋友喜欢在liux平台下直接修改系统文件,结果导致权限问题。
正确做法是:
- 先用
sudo -i
切换到root - 修改前用
cp config.conf config.conf.bak
做备份 - 修改后记得
systemctl restart 服务名
重启服务
liux平台下的生产力工具链
开发环境配置技巧
在liux平台搭建开发环境时,我强烈推荐使用Docker容器。
相比Windows的虚拟机方案,liux平台原生支持容器技术,资源占用少得多:
方案 | 内存占用 | 启动速度 |
---|
Windows虚拟机 | ≥4GB | 2-3分钟 |
liux平台容器 | ≤1GB | 10秒内 |
办公套件选择
虽然Windows的Office确实好用,但在liux平台下我们也有替代方案:
- WPS Office - 兼容性最好的国产套件
- OnlyOffice - 最接近MS Office的体验
- LibreOffice - 开源社区的首选
小技巧:用
wine
运行Windows版Office,但稳定性要看人品~
liux平台系统优化三板斧
1. 开机速度优化
在liux平台下排查启动慢的问题,记住这个命令组合:
systemd-analyze blame
→ 查看各服务启动耗时
systemctl disable 服务名
→ 禁用不必要服务
2. 内存管理技巧
Windows用户最不习惯的就是liux平台的内存使用策略:
占用高≠性能差! liux会主动缓存常用文件到内存。
真实内存占用要看
free -h
的available列。
3. 磁盘空间清理
在liux平台下,这几个目录最容易"发福":
- /var/log - 日志文件
- /var/cache - 软件缓存
- ~/.cache - 用户缓存
用
ncdu
工具可视化分析磁盘占用,比Windows的资源管理器更直观!
给liux平台新手的终极建议
最后分享一个真实案例:我团队有个从Windows转来的小伙,前三个月天天抱怨liux平台难用。
后来他做了这三件事,现在已经是团队里的liux平台专家:
- 每天掌握1个新命令(用
man
查用法) - 遇到问题先查日志(
journalctl -xe
) - 定期备份重要数据(
tar -zcvf backup.tar.gz /path
)
记住:liux平台不是难用,只是和Windows的设计哲学不同。
当你习惯了命令行的高效,可能就再也回不去图形界面了!
互动时间:你在liux平台下遇到的最大挑战是什么?评论区告诉我,下期可能就会专门为你解答!